Cartsdyke boasts essential facilities to cater to its passengers' needs. Unfortunately, the station lacks ticket machines, but you can purchase and collect your tickets from the ticket office, which has varied opening times throughout the week. For those who have already secured their tickets online, collection is straightforward and convenient at the ticket office itself, open from 06:40 to 13:44 on weekdays and 09:20 to 16:28 on Saturdays.
For your convenience and assistance, Cartsdyke offers customer help points and staff assistance during the ticket office's operational hours. While there are no refreshments or shopping facilities on site, you will find basic seating areas and a few bicycle stands for travelers who prefer cycling. Moreover, the station offers limited step-free access and no accessibility for wheelchairs or accessible toilets, which might be a constraint for travelers with specific mobility requirements.
Cartsdyke's connectivity extends beyond the train lines, with several transport alternatives available for your onward journey. The rail replacement services ensure minimal disruption to your travel plans, with buses conveniently picking up and dropping off near East Hamilton Street. For more details on exact bus locations, use the What3Words reference: play.renew.rank.
If a taxi ride suits your needs, a visit to traintaxi.co.uk will provide the necessary information on taxi services from the station. Local bus services operate frequently, and for up-to-date route information, Traveline Scotland is your go-to source.

While Rice Lane doesn't boast a ticket office or machines, ticket collection for those purchased online is still possible, adding a layer of convenience for tech-savvy passengers. This station ensures a seamless experience with smartcard validators, making it easy to hop on and off your train with almost no delay. Accessibility is something to be considered if you're relying on step-free access, as Rice Lane is a Category C station without it. However, assistance is readily available via a help point and customer information screens, enabling you to stay informed about your journey.
The station offers service staff ready to assist from early morning until late evening. Staff are available from as early as 05:38 AM, ensuring that even the earliest of risers have assistance if needed. For those requiring extra support, the Passenger Assist service can be requested up to two hours before the journey. Although the station lacks dedicated parking facilities and step-free access, nearby Orrell Park provides the necessary facilities for passengers with reduced mobility.
Rice Lane features straightforward connections to other modes of transport. While there is no taxi rank on site, the station is well-connected by local bus services. For international travelers, Liverpool John Lennon Airport is readily accessible via a convenient train and bus combo. Simply catch a train to Liverpool South Parkway and hop on the 86A or 80A bus for a swift journey to the airport in approximately 10 minutes.
